Chevrolet have maintained their strong record at Brands Hatch, winning a race on every appearance – though this time it was Yvan Muller who took that victory and extends his lead.
Andy Priaulx has won the second race at Brands Hatch ahead of reigning BTCC champion Colin Turkington, with SR-Sport’s Gabriele Tarquini finishing third in a incident packed race.
Yvan Muller has taken victory in the first race at Brands Hatch, with local drivers Rob Huff and Colin Turkington completing the podium.
Colin Turkington has set the fastest time for the second session this weekend, ahead of the works BMW’s of Andy Priaulx & Augusto Farfus.
Tim Coronel will replace Andrei Romanov at Liqui-Moly Team Engstler for this weekends round at Brands Hatch, as Romanov can’t take part for personal reasons.
The World Touring Car Championship returns to Brands Hatch for the fifth consecutive year this weekend.
The BMW, the SEAT, the Chevrolet and the Volvo is going to be on maximum penalty weight for Brands Hatch.
Tom Boardman is going to take part in the FIA World Touring Car Championship event at Brands Hatch.
Brazilian Stock Car champion Carlos ‘Cacá’ Bueno will be the latest driver to drive a fourth Chevrolet Cruze at the Brands Hatch round of the championship.
